The SilverZone STEM Innovation Olympiad is a prestigious national-level competition organized by the SilverZone Foundation. It aims to promote a deeper understanding of STEM subjects (Science, Technology, Engineering, and Mathematics) and their real-world applications among students from classes 1 to 10.

Exam Pattern
The SilverZone STEM Innovation Olympiad is structured to assess students’ understanding and application of STEM subjects through a well-defined exam pattern. Here are the key details regarding the structure of the exam, including the duration and number of questions for each class.
Structure of the Exam
- Objective Type Questions: The exam consists entirely of objective-type questions, which require students to select the correct answer from multiple choices.
- Language Medium: The examination is conducted in English only.
Duration and Number of Questions by Class
The exam pattern varies by class, as follows:
- Classes 1-2:
- Number of Questions: 25
- Duration: 40 minutes
- Classes 3-5:
- Number of Questions: 35
- Duration: 40 minutes
- Classes 6-10:
- Number of Questions: 40
- Duration: 50 minutes
Additional Information
- No Negative Marking: There is no penalty for incorrect answers, encouraging students to attempt all questions.
- OMR Answer Sheets: Starting from Class 3, students will use Optical Mark Recognition (OMR) answer sheets for their responses.
- Conducting Body: The exam is organized by the SilverZone Foundation, which is responsible for setting the question papers based on the syllabus provided for the respective classes.
Silverzone STEM Olympiad Class Wise Syllabus
Class 1
Section A: Science: Plants, Living and Non-Living Things, Animals, Food, Air and Water, Human Body.
Section B: Technology & Engineering: Introduction to Computer, Uses of Computer, Parts of Computer, Introduction to Artificial Intelligence, Intelligence Assessment with Logical Reasoning.
Section C: Mathematics: Numbers and its Counting, Operation of Addition and Subtraction , Money, Time, Measuring Length, weight and Volume, Identifying Patterns, Visualizing Shapes.
Class 2
Section A: Science: Animals; Plants; Food, Air and Water; Human Body; Our Universe.
Section B: Technology & Engineering: Section B (Technology & Engineering): Introduction to Computer, Types of computer, Uses of Computer, Parts of Computer, Working of Computer, Keyboard and Mouse, Introduction to Artificial Intelligence, Intelligence Assessment with Logical Reasoning.
Section C: Mathematics: Knowing Numbers, Fundamental Operation of Numbers, Patterns, Uses of Numbers in Daily Life, Measurement, Identifying 2D and 3D Shapes.
Class 3
Section A: Science: Understanding motion: Force and its impact; The magical world of planets, moons and stars; The three physical states of matter; Sensors of the human body; Kingdom of plants and animals.
Section B: Technology & Engineering: (Information Technology)
Information Technology – Introduction to Hardware and Software, Usage of the Internet; Coding using ‘Scratch’ – Block-based Programming Language (Beginner), Introduction to Artificial Intelligence [AI vs Human Intelligence], Intelligence assessment with Logical Reasoning.
Section C: Mathematics:
- Exploring Numbers
- Splitting a Number; Daily Mathematics; Geometrical Shapes; Working on Data
Class 4
Section A: Science
- Forces and their applications: Force, effects of forces, different types of force.
- Energy and its different forms: Energy, different types of energy
- Our magical solar system: Our solar system, sun, planets
- The three physical states of matter: Solids, Liquids, Gases, Melting, Evaporation, Condensation, Freezing
- Kingdom of plants and animals: Different types of plants, Animals and their habitats
- Systems inside our body: Digestive systems, Respiratory system, Circulatory system
Section B: Technology & Engineering
- Information Technology – More on Hardware and Software, Application of Internet and Security
- Coding using ‘Scratch’ – Block based Programming Language (Intermediate)
- Introduction to Artificial Intelligence [AI Smart Homes]
- Intelligence assessment with Logical Reasoning
Section C: Mathematics
- Working with Numbers: Addition, Subtraction, Multiplication and Division of Numbers
- Dividing A Whole: Applying Fractions
- Everyday Mathematics: Time, Money, Measuring Length, Mass and Capacity
- Understanding Geometrical Shapes: Geometrical Figures, Patterns
- Representing Data: Pictograph, Bar Graph
Class 5
Section A: Science
- Force, work & energy: Frictional force, Magnetic force, Gravitational force, Elastic force, Work, Energy
- The simple machines: Lever, Plane, Pulley, Wheel & Axle, Screw
- Light: The fastest thing: Light, Reflection, Transparency, Luminous & Non-luminous
- Forces of nature: natural calamities: Earthquake, Flood, Drought, Cyclone
- Imagine the unimaginable: Universe: Solar system, Planets, Constellations
- Systems inside our body: Skeletal system, Nervous system, Circulatory system
Section B: Technology & Engineering
- Information Technology – Computer Fundamental, Windows OS, Introduction to MS-Office, Internet and communication
- Introduction and basics of Programming Language
- Coding using ‘Scratch’ – Block based Programming Language (Advanced)
- Artificial Intelligence [Domains of AI]
- Intelligence assessment with Logical Reasoning
Section C: Mathematics
- Number Sense and Numeration: Numbers and Their Operations, Factors and Multiples
- Understanding Fractions: Fractions and Decimals
- Ratio and Its Application: Ratio and Proportion, Percentage, Time and Distance,
- Geometrical shapes: Angle, Polygon and Circle, Perimeter and Area of Geometrical shapes
- Handling Data: Handling Data and its Representation
Class 6
Section A: Science
- Everyday science: Materials, Properties of materials, Grouping materials, Separation of components of mixture
- Story of Movement: Transport, measurement, Motion
- Light rays and their interesting behaviour: Light, Reflection, Shadow, Transparency, Luminous and Non-luminous objects
- Magic of magnet: Magnet, Poles of magnet, Magnetic and Non-magnetic materials, Compass
- Current and its path: Electricity, Electric circuits, Conductors, Insulators, Dry cell, Bulb
- Movement in living world: Human skeletal system, Joints, Gait of animals
Section B: Technology & Engineering
- AI: Introduction to AI, The Birth of AI, Understanding AI, Future of AI, New Technologies (Augmented Reality)
- Coding: Introduction of Coding, Algorithms with Block Coding, Variables using Block Coding, Control with Conditionals, Loops using Block Coding
- Intelligence assessment with Logical Reasoning: Series Completion, Blood Relation, Direction Sense Test, Geometrical Shapes, Mirror and Water Reflections
Section C: Mathematics
- Numbers and its Operations: Whole Numbers, Simplification of Numbers, Factors and Multiples, Fractions and Decimals
- Comparing Quantities: Ratio and Proportion
- Algebra: Algebraic Expressions
- Geometry: Lines and Angles, Elementary Geometrical Shapes
- Mensuration: Perimeter, Area
- Data Handling: Graphical representation of data
Class 7
Section A: Science
- Light and its interaction with objects: Rectilinear property of light, Laws of reflections, Object & image, Mirrors, Lenses, Dispersion of light
- Current and its effects: Electric components, Electric circuits, Heating effect of current, Magnetic effect of current, Electromagnet, Fuse
- Concept of Motion and Time: Uniform and Non-uniform motion, Graphical representation of motion, Time
- Understanding temperature: Heat, Flow of heat, Thermometers
- Sour, bitter and salty taste of substances: Acids, Bases, Salts
- Components of Environment: Soil, Air, Water, Forest
- The processes that make life possible: Nutrition, Human digestive system, Human respiratory system, Human circulatory system
Section B: Technology & Engineering
- AI: Introduction to AI, Application Area of AI, Ethics of AI, Future of AI, New Technologies [Virtual Reality]
- Coding: Understanding Programming Languages, Variable in Real Life, Sequencing with Block Coding, Fun with Functions, Understanding Arrays and Collections
- Intelligence assessment with Logical Reasoning
Series Completion, Blood Relation, Analogy and Classification, Coding & Decoding, Cubes and Dice
Section C: Mathematics
- Number System: Integers, Simplifying Arithmetic expressions, Fractions and Decimals, Rational Numbers, Exponents
- Algebra: Algebraic Expressions, Simple Equations
- Comparing Quantities: Ratio and Proportion, Percentage, Profit and Loss, Simple Interest
- Geometry: Lines and Angles, Triangles, Quadrilaterals, Solid shapes,Symmetry
- Handling Data: Mean, mode and Median, Bar graphs
- Mensuration: Perimeter, Area and Volume
Class 8
Section A: Science
- Some important physical quantities: Light, Electricity, Force, Sound
- Some natural phenomena: Electric charge, Electroscope, Lightening, Earthquake
- Important Materials: Metals, Non-metals, Fibres, Plastics
- World Beyond Earth: Stars, Galaxy, Constellation, Solar system, Satellites, Comets, Meteors
- Systems inside human body: Reproductive system, Circulatory system, Excretory system
Section B: Technology & Engineering
- AI: Introduction to AI, History of AI, Application of AI, Future of AI, AI Ethics and Bias
- Coding: Conditionals in Details, Get Creative with Loops, Functions
- Intelligence assessment with Logical Reasoning: Series Completion, Classification, Direction Sense Test, Coding & Decoding, Image Reflection
Section C: Mathematics
- Rational Numbers: Rational Numbers, Exponents, Square and Square Root, Cube and Cube Root
- Algebra: Algebraic Expression, Factorization, Linear Equation
- Geometry: Convex and Concave polygon
- Ratio and its Application: Direct and inverse proportions, Percentage,Discount and Taxes, Compound Interest
- Mensuration: Surface area and volume of Cube, Cuboid and Cylinder
- Handling Data: Introduction to graphs, Line graphs, Pie Chart, Probability of an event
Class 9
Section A: Science
- Chemical composition of our physical world: Matter, Metals, Non-metals, Metalloids, Mixture, Atoms, Molecules
- Force & Motion: Motion, Displacement, Acceleration, Equations of motion, Force, Newton’s law of motion
- Gravitation: Universal law of gravitation, Free fall, Pressure, Buoyancy
- Work & Energy: Work, Forms of energy, Conservation of energy, Power
- Sound: Sound, Propagation of sound, Types of waves, Human ear
- Cell and Tissues: Cell, Cell organelles, Tissues, Plant tissues, Animal tissues
Section B: Technology & Engineering
- AI: Introduction to AI, AI Project Cycle, Neural Networks
- Coding: Coding with Python – Intermediate
- Intelligence Assessment with Logical Reasoning: Series Completion, Blood Relation, Syllogism, Inserting Missing Number, Figures Sequence
Section C: Mathematics
- Rational Numbers: Irrational Numbers, Real Numbers and their Decimal Expansions, Operation on Real Numbers, Laws of Exponents for Real Numbers
- Algebra: Polynomials in one variable, Zeros of a polynomial, Factorization of polynomials, Algebraic Identities
- Linear Equation and Coordinate Geometry: Linear equation in two variables, Solution of Linear equations, Coordinate geometry
- Geometry: Lines and angles, Triangles, Quadrilaterals, Circles
- Handling Data: Bar graphs,Histogram,Frequency Polygon
- Mensuration: Surface Area and Volume
Class 10
Section A: Science
- Chemical elements and their properties: Metals, Non-metals, Metallurgy, Carbon, Compounds of carbon
- Life Processes: Nutrition, Modes of nutrition, Respiration, Transportation, Control and coordination
- Light and Image formation: Reflection, Mirror formula, Magnification, Refraction, Lens formula, Human eye
- Flow of electrons and magnetism: Electricity, Electric potential, Ohm’s law, Combination of resistances, Electrical energy, Magnetism, Magnetic field lines, Electromagnet, Electric motor, Electric generator
- Energy and its sources: Renewable and non-renewable sources of energy, Fuel
Section B: Technology & Engineering
- AI: Foundational Concepts of AI, Understanding AI Project Cycle, Computer Vision and Evaluation
- Coding: Coding with Python – Advance
- Intelligence assessment with Logical Reasoning: Direction Test, Venn Diagram, Logical Sequence, Mathematical Operations, Coding & Decoding
Section C: Mathematics
- Real Numbers and Number Series: Real numbers and its representation on Number Line, Laws of Exponents, Arithmetic Progression
- Polynomials: Polynomials, Pair of Linear equations in two variables, Quadratic equation, Cartesian Coordinate System
- Geometry: Triangles, Similar figures, Similarity of Triangles, Areas of Similar triangles, Circles, Tangent to a circle
- Trigonometry and its Application: Trigonometry, Height and Distance
- Mensuration: Surface Area and Volume
- Statistics and Probability: Mean, Mode and Median of grouped Data, Probability of Events
